NOTICE OF VIOLATION The.Childrens Hospital License No. 34-03111-02 As a result of the inspection conducted on August 20, 1981, and in accord-ance with the Interim Enforcement Policy, 45 FR 66754 (October 7,1980),

the following violation was identified:

License Condition No. 20 states that the licensee shall possess and use

.l Pensed material in accordance with statements, representations and pro-cedu.es listed in the application dated December 27, 1977.

Item No.10 of the application requires that the linearity test of your dose calibrator be carried out over 48 hours5.555556e-4 days <br />0.0133 hours <br />7.936508e-5 weeks <br />1.8264e-5 months <br />.

Contrary to the above, linearity tests performed on your dose calibrator have only been carried out over 24 hours2.777778e-4 days <br />0.00667 hours <br />3.968254e-5 weeks <br />9.132e-6 months <br />.

This is a Severity Level V violation (Supplement VII).

Pursuant to the provisions of 10 CFR 2.201, you are required to subsi+ to this office withia thirty days of the date of this Notice a written statement or explanation in reply, including for each item of noncompliance:

(1) cor-rective action taken and the results achieved; (2) corrective action to be taken to avoid further noncompliance; and (3) the date when full compliance will be achieved. Under the authority of Section 182 of the Atomic Energy Act of 1954, as amended, this response shall ba submitted under oath or affirmation. Consideration may be given to extending your response time for good cause shown.
